Jason Smith Obituary

Smith, Jason Patrick Dwight
March 19, 1972 – July 6, 2024

It is with immense sorrow that we announce the passing of our dear Jason at the age of 52. Jason was loved by many people throughout his journey in life. He was known as the fun loving (crazy at times) brother who enjoyed life to its fullest. He had a heart of gold and loved all his kids/grandkids/nephews/nieces/cousins/friends. He was always proud of his family and friends’ accomplishments. Jay’s brother, Cassius, recalls: “I still remember the day he introduced me to Metallica when I was a teenager. I was not into heavy metal music but when I heard him playing the Metallica - Black album in his bedroom. I knocked on his door and I said" who is that? Sounds pretty cool. I have to get that CD" yeah he loved Metallica.” Jason was a carpenter and an outdoorsman and he worked with pride on his projects. Jason enjoyed the company of his friends and enjoyed laughing and sharing jokes and making people laugh. If you were loved by Jason, he made darn sure that you knew it. We will all miss Jay. Jason had a special bond with his Mama Bear Darlene, sharing travels and adventures and many tender mother/son moments. Jason treasured his mom and she will miss him until they are reunited.
